Amber gold with good, creamy, white head / Bright ose of citrus and cut pine / Medium body, chewy and creamy, with fine, balanced body featuring only modestly biting hops and good, bitter, finish / Mellow flavors of orange, grapefruit, cut pine, bubblegum, and resin / Tastes like more of a regular pale than a double, with only a modest hop profile and bitterness levels. It is a very nice pale, though, with lovely flavor and balance.

On tap for growler fills at Half Time. Pours a lightly hazed golden amber with a thin to medium sized white head. Bright sticky citrus, juicy, with a touch of mango and tropical fruit, pineapple. Big malt, toast and sweet toasted fruit notes. Earthy,, not as much hops as expected given the nose. Long bitter grapefruit finish.

Draft at Haymarket, pours clear golden with foamy white head. Nose has pine, grapefruit, with sweet candy sugar undertones. Flavors are sweet mango and pineapple, candy sugar, some banana and oranges, healthy bitterness. Full mouth feel. Good beer but sorta like those great iipa of 5 years ago (good hop flavor but just too sweet). Little boozy too.

Cask @ Blind Tiger. Hazy amber with a small off-white head, faded to a thick film and lasted the duration. Spicy orange herbal hop nose followed by some sweet malts and alcohol heat. Smells a little fresher than the flavor. Flavor has orange hops dominating with some spicy earth and dry hopped notes, light toast and caramel sweetness. Finishes earthy and semi-dry with bitterness peaking at a 4, some alcohol noted. Lots of earth. Low carbonation with a medium body. Not bad, but nothing stands out. And far too earthy.
